Brown splatter near windshield washer tank - oil? V70-XC70

I'll try to get pictures up. The brown marks almost look like rust-colored (or tan colored) corrosion but they are on plastic so I guess something splattered. There is not a lot of this but I am worried this is the beginning of something bad. It is also near the passenger side headlamp area of the black metal 'deck' in that area. (The place where one might rest a wrench when working under the hood). It is as if something came down from above. I can't seem to trace a source. Maybe oil is being kicked up by a belt? It is not a big mess. Any ideas?
